The Role of Daily Maintenance on Hardwood Floors
Hardwood flooring is susceptible to micro-scratches caused by sand, grit, and even fine dust particles. These abrasives act like sandpaper every time someone walks across the floor. Over weeks and months, this leads to visible dullness, especially in high-traffic areas.
Daily sweeping or vacuuming removes these damaging particles before they embed into the grain or get ground into the finish. Mopping, while excellent for removing sticky spills and deep-set grime, should not be performed daily. Excess moisture can warp wood, cause cupping, or compromise the sealant—particularly with solid hardwood.
This creates a clear division of labor: dry cleaning (vacuuming) for daily protection, wet cleaning (mopping) for periodic refreshment. A robot vacuum excels at the former by maintaining consistency without requiring effort from the homeowner.
Robot Vacuums: Advantages for Hardwood Floors
Modern robot vacuums are engineered specifically for hard surfaces. High-end models use advanced sensors to avoid collisions, map rooms intelligently, and adjust suction power based on floor type. For hardwood owners, several key benefits stand out:
- Consistency: Schedules allow daily cleanings, even when you’re away.
- Edge Cleaning: Side brushes sweep debris from corners and along walls.
- Gentle Operation: Most use soft rubber rollers instead of bristle brushes, reducing scratch risk.
- Smart Navigation: LiDAR or camera-based mapping ensures full coverage without random bumping.
- Low Maintenance: Empty the bin weekly; minimal user involvement required.
Brands like iRobot, Roborock, and Ecovacs offer models with hardwood-specific modes that reduce suction slightly to preserve finish longevity while still capturing fine dust. Some even integrate mopping functions with controlled water output to prevent oversaturation.

Mopping: When It’s Necessary—and When It’s Not Enough
Mopping remains essential for eliminating sticky residues, footprints, and allergens that vacuuming can't reach. However, relying solely on mopping leaves floors vulnerable between cleanings. A spill might dry into a film, or tracked-in pollen could settle into seams where moisture later activates mold growth.
Traditional string mops often push debris around rather than lifting it. Wet mops also require drying time, during which floors remain unsafe for bare feet or pets. Steam mops pose additional risks: excessive heat and moisture can penetrate wood layers, leading to warping or delamination over time.
The biggest limitation of mopping is frequency. Most people mop once a week at best. That means six days of unchecked particle accumulation—each step grinding dust deeper into the finish. Even meticulous homeowners struggle to maintain daily dry cleaning routines manually.
Step-by-Step: Optimal Hardwood Floor Care Routine
- Daily: Run robot vacuum on hardwood-safe mode (soft roller brush, medium suction).
- Every 2–3 Days: Spot-clean spills with a microfiber cloth dampened with pH-neutral cleaner.
- Weekly: Perform a targeted mop using a flat microfiber mop with controlled water release.
- Monthly: Inspect for scratches, reapply polish if needed, and clean baseboards.
- Seasonally: Check humidity levels (ideal: 35–55%) to prevent expansion or gaps.

When a Regular Mop Might Suffice
A robot vacuum isn’t mandatory for every household. In some cases, a regular mop combined with manual sweeping may be adequate:
- Low-Traffic Homes: Single occupants or retirees with no pets or children.
- Small Spaces: Studios or apartments under 600 sq ft are easier to clean manually.
- Budget Constraints: If $300+ is prohibitive, focus on frequent dry microfiber mopping.
- Short-Term Living: Renters planning to move within 1–2 years may not need long-term protection.
In these situations, diligence matters more than equipment. Using a dry microfiber mop daily (without chemicals) can lift dust effectively. Pair this with weekly damp mopping using a nearly dry cloth to minimize moisture exposure.

Frequently Asked Questions
Can robot vacuums scratch hardwood floors?
Most modern robot vacuums designed for hard floors use soft rubber rollers instead of bristle brushes, significantly reducing scratch risk. Avoid older models with stiff side brushes or those lacking anti-scratch safeguards. Always check manufacturer specifications for hardwood compatibility.
How often should I mop if I have a robot vacuum?
Mop every 7–10 days depending on activity level. High-traffic homes or those with pets may benefit from weekly mopping. Use a nearly dry microfiber pad and a cleaner approved for engineered or solid hardwood to avoid residue or moisture damage.
Do hybrid robot vacuums with mopping functions replace traditional mopping?
They supplement it but don’t fully replace it. Hybrid models like the Roborock S8 or iRobot Combo j9+ provide light scrubbing with precise water control, ideal for light spills or footprints. However, they lack the scrubbing pressure of manual mopping for stuck-on messes. Use them for maintenance, not deep cleaning.
